Sadak 2 is an Indian Hindi language Action-Drama-Romance film. Featuring Sanjay Dutt, Pooja Bhatt, Aditya Roy Kapur & Alia Bhatt in the lead roles. The film is produced by Mukesh Bhatt of Vishesh Films; it was co-written and Directed by Mahesh Bhatt. The film's production began in June 2018.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, the film was not be released theatrically and it was streamed worldwide on 28st August, 2020 on Disney+Hotstar [India].

Sadak 2 is the sequel to the 1991 film Sadak. The sequel stars Sanjay Dutt, Alia Bhatt, Pooja Bhatt and Aditya Roy Kapur. Sadak 2 marks Mahesh Bhatt's return as a director after 20 years. The film is about Ravi's depression and how he helps a young woman's encounter with a godman, who is out to expose this fake guru running an ashram.

The film was scheduled to be released on 25 March 2020, but was pushed to 10 July 2020, It was again pulled from the release schedule as the shooting was delayed because of COVID-19 pandemic lockdown in India. On 29 June 2020, Disney+ Hotstar conducted virtual press conference where Alia Bhatt announced that the film will release on Disney+ Hotstar exclusively as part of Disney+ Hotstar Multiplex initiative which was a result of theatre shut down due to COVID-19 pandemic.

The music for the film was composed by Jeet Gannguli, Ankit Tiwari, Samidh Mukherjee, Urvi and Suniljeet while the lyrics written by Rashmi Virag, Vijay Vijawatt, Shabbir Ahmed, Suniljeet and Shalu Vaish.

(6) Sadak 2 Story:
Sadak 2 is the story of a girl trying to expose a powerful godman. Aryaa (Played By Alia Bhatt) has lost her mother Shakuntala to cancer but she feels that it’s because of the involvement of a godman Gyaan Prakash (Played By Makarand Deshpande). Her father, Yogesh Desai (Played By Jisshu Sengupta) is a devout follower of Gyaan Prakash and he fails to realize the truth. He even gets married to Shakuntala’s sister Nandini (Played By Priyanka Bose), also a follower of Gyaan Prakash. Aryaa meanwhile starts an online campaign against this godman and gets close to 2 lakh followers. It also helps her meet Vishal (Played By Aditya Roy Kapur) and both soon start a relationship. All is going well but one day, Gyaan Prakash attempts to kill Aarya by sending a henchman. Vishal, however, kills the henchman for which he’s jailed. Aryaa is sent to a mental asylum and falsely declared mentally ill. Her online activities are also ceased. She, however, escapes from the hospital and decides to go to Mount Kailash. This is because her 21st birthday is round the corner and her mother had wished that she visit this holy place on this important day of her life. She books a cab three months in advance from Pooja Travels and Tours, run by Pooja (Played By Pooja Bhatt) and her husband Ravi (Played By Sanjay Dutt). After Pooja accepts the booking, she dies in a road accident. Ravi is shattered and turns suicidal. This is when Aryaa lands up at his place and demands to go to Ranikhet from where she’s supposed to take a chopper to Mount Kailash. Ravi reluctantly accepts the booking, because of Pooja’s reference. The journey begins and both end up telling each other about the sorrows of their lives. Incidentally, Vishal, too, gets released from the prison and he also joins in the journey. Unfortunately, Gyaan Prakash’s men catch up with the trio. The godman sends his most devoted disciple, Dilip Hathkataa (Played By Gulshan Grover), to finish them off. What happens next forms the rest of the film.
